python怎么安装smt库
时间: 2023-10-19 21:21:36 浏览: 278
smt是一个开源的Python库,用于进行统计建模和预测建模的工具包。你可以通过以下步骤安装smt库:
1. 确保你已经安装了Python解释器,可以在命令行中输入`python --version`来检查Python版本。
2. 打开命令行终端,输入以下命令来安装smt库:
```
pip install smt
```
3. 如果你想升级已经安装的smt库,可以使用以下命令:
```
pip install --upgrade smt
```
4. 安装完成后,你可以在Python代码中使用smt库,例如:
```python
import smt
```
希望这可以帮到你。
相关问题
python SMT
SMT 在计算机科学中代表着统计机器翻译(Statistical Machine Translation)。而 Python 是一种流行的编程语言。如果你对于 Python 中的 SMT 相关内容感兴趣,你可以使用 Python 中的一些库来实现统计机器翻译,比如 `nltk` 或者 `gensim`。这些库提供了一些算法和工具,可以帮助你构建和训练统计机器翻译模型。你也可以使用其他的库或者框架,具体取决于你的需求和项目要求。
SMT系统Moses在linux上安装
安装 Moses 需要以下步骤:
1. 安装依赖项
在 Ubuntu 上,可以通过以下命令安装 Moses 所需的依赖项:
```
sudo apt-get update
sudo apt-get install g++ git-core \
automake libtool zlib1g-dev \
libboost-all-dev libbz2-dev \
liblzma-dev cmake libgoogle-perftools-dev \
python-dev graphviz imagemagick
```
2. 克隆 Moses 代码库
使用以下命令在本地计算机上克隆 Moses 代码库:
```
git clone https://github.com/moses-smt/mosesdecoder.git
```
3. 编译和安装 Moses
进入 `mosesdecoder` 目录,并使用以下命令编译和安装 Moses:
```
cd mosesdecoder
./bjam -j4
sudo ./install.sh
```
其中 `-j4` 参数指定编译时使用 4 个处理器核心。
4. 配置环境变量
为了使命令行中的 Moses 命令可用,需要将其添加到系统 `PATH` 环境变量中。可以通过编辑 `.bashrc` 文件来实现这一点:
```
nano ~/.bashrc
```
在文件底部添加以下行:
```
export PATH="/path/to/mosesdecoder/bin:$PATH"
```
替换 `/path/to/mosesdecoder` 为你的 `mosesdecoder` 文件夹的路径。
保存并关闭文件后,使用以下命令使更改生效:
```
source ~/.bashrc
```
现在,你已经成功在 Linux 上安装了 Moses SMT 系统。
阅读全文